U-turn would be realy good for mons such as Flygon as Karx mentioned above. I think being able to drop Hp bug and having a banded set of Eq and U-turn with much more filler options now is neat. These include: Fire Blast, Toxic, Rock slide, and then any hidden power. This makes Flygon 100% more versatile and a much bigger threat in general, probably to high A rank Material (S is a bit high due to lack of capabilities of hitting bulky waters even when banded).
Other nice mon that could get this is Jirachi, which could open up a bit more potential for a physical set with U-turn, Body Slam, Doom Desire, Wish while still being an obviously potent Calm minder. This can make Jirachi a potenital dugtrio lure (IP doesnt kill if Duggy has some HP invested or if Jirachi is bulky CM) of sorts when used with Defensive DD mence to crush Dugtrio, potenitaly opening a sweep for CM Rachi (which would forgo wish I suppose on a lire U-turn set) or even a Raikou sweep.
Also, Doom Desire activating on the third turn could be helpful as well, Duggy comes in turn 1 on a doom desire. Turn 2 Jirachi takes around 95 from banded eq and proceeds to U-Turn, which can bring in something that forces potential desire resists to stay and retains (something such as bp celebi). This keeps offensive momentum up while notching a hit on something. In theory, a physical set is gimmicky but could possibly work.
The issue is the limited use of U-turn within the tier itself, so in reality, while it should make an impact on Dugtrio's trapping abilities, in reality it doesnt with only 2 notable mons learning it.
